To automatically save names and
phone numbers on the SIM card
• When Phone contacts is selected
as default, from standby select Menu
} Contacts } More } Options
} Advanced } Auto save on SIM
and select On.
Memory status
The number of contacts you can
save in the phone or on the SIM card
depends on available memory.
To view memory status
• From standby select Menu
} Contacts } More } Options
} Advanced } Memory status.
Using contacts
Contacts can be used in many ways.
Below you can see how to:
• Call phone and SIM contacts.
• Send phone contacts to another
device.
• Copy contacts to phone and
SIM card.
• Add a picture or a ringtone to
a phone contact.
• Edit contacts.
• Synchronize your contacts.
To call a phone contact
1 From standby select Menu }
Contacts. Scroll to, or enter the first
letter or letters of the contact.
2 When the contact is highlighted press
or to select a number } Call
to make a voice call, or } More
} Make video call to make a video call.
To call a SIM contact
• If SIM contacts is default, from standby
select Menu } Contacts and when the
contact is highlighted press or
to select a number. } Call to make
a voice call, or } More } Make video
call to make a video call.
• If Phone contacts is set as default
from standby select Menu } Contacts
} More } Options } SIM contacts
and select the contact } Call to make
a voice call, or }
More } Make video
call to make a video call.
To send a contact
• From standby select Menu
} Contacts and select a contact
} More } Send contact and select
a transfer method.
To send all contacts
• From standby select Menu } Contacts
} More } Options } Advanced
} Send all contacts and select
a transfer method.
